    Saropoly is a satirical board game about the music industry published by British independent record label Sarah Records as their fiftieth 'single'. It was packaged as a 7" single but contained a fold-out board and a wooden die.

    Players take on the roles of four contemporary record label bosses - Alan McGee (Creation), Tony Wilson (Factory), Richard Branson (Virgin) and Ivo Watts-Russell (4AD) - who must travel around the city of Bristol, south-west England, to collect the eight essential ingredients required to publish a Sarah Records EP, with the first player to do so and successfully return to the Sarah Records head office being the winner.
